There is an explicit requirement that any money raised from EIS investments must be for the company’s organic growth and development. Provided that the EIS Advance Assurance has confirmed that the repayment of the loan to the individual is for the company’s organic growth and development, an investment by the individual several months later would not be connected to the original loan. Is a later investment connected to the original loan? If the loan was converted into ordinary shares, this would constitute a return of value and would not qualify for EIS relief. The individual was making a loan of £100,000 to the company. In order to claim EIS relief there must be a subscription of new funds.

The trade was expected to be a qualifying trade for EIS purposes. The EIS shares would be issued within seven years of the first commercial sale of the business. Our client was a trading company providing branding and recruitment services. The repayment of the loan cannot be in pursuance of any arrangements for or in connection with the acquisition of shares. This means that the loan cannot be converted into shares. The loan will need to be repaid before and separately from the issue of further shares. The loan must have been repaid before the EIS investment is made. The company will need to show in the EIS Advance Assurance application that the repayment of this loan is part of an overall programme of growth and development. Our advice as to the conditions the lender investor needed to satisfy were: Condition 1 We established that if two conditions were met the lender could also be an EIS investor. Gannons advised on whether an individual who had previously made a loan to an EIS company could also qualify for EIS relief on his investment.
